1.1 理解需求 在开始开发之前,首先需要明确应用的需求,包括功能、界面设计等。 1.2 设计应用 根据需求设计应用的架构和界面布局,确定桌面级应用的整体结构。 1.3 编写代码 根据设计好的应用架构和界面布局,开始编写JAVA代码实现应用功能。 1.4 测试 在开发完成后,需要进行测试,确保应用的功能正常运行并且没有bug。 1.5...
Java桌面应用程序框架的应用场景: Java桌面应用程序框架的应用场景非常广泛,包括以下几个方面: 企业管理系统:用于管理企业的日常运营和业务流程。 教育软件:用于教授学生知识和技能。 办公软件:用于处理文档、表格、演示文稿等办公任务。 游戏:Java桌面应用程序框架也可以用于开发游戏。
AWT(Abstract Window Toolkit)是Java最早提供的用于构建桌面应用程序的GUI框架。它是Java中GUI开发的基础,提供了一组基本的GUI组件和布局选项。然而,AWT的功能相对较弱,界面效果也较为简单。以下是一个简单的AWT应用程序示例: importjava.awt.*;importjava.awt.event.*;publicclassAWTApp{publicstaticvoidmain(String[...
3、SpringSpring 可以说是排在Java框架第一位,是由于它能够开发以高性能著称的复杂web应用程序的出色能力。它能够使Java开发人员轻松地创建企业级应用程序。 4、Mock 测试是现代单元测试的关键技术之一,开发者不需要依赖其他情况也可独立测试代码,因此我建议每个 Java 开发人员都应该学习 Mock 框架来与 JUnit 结合使用。
Viewa框架是一款专为Java桌面应用程序设计的工具,它基于Swing技术构建,并采用了MVC(Model-View-Controller)设计模式。这一模式通过将应用程序的数据模型、用户界面和控制逻辑分离,显著提升了代码的可维护性和可扩展性。利用Viewa框架,开发者能够更加高效地构建桌面应用,同时保证代码的整洁与模块化。框架还支持在不同视图...
cloudrail java桌面应用程序 CloudRail Java桌面应用程序是一个用于开发云集成的Java桌面应用程序的框架。它提供了一套简单易用的API,使开发人员能够轻松地集成各种云服务,如文件存储、社交媒体、电子邮件等,而无需关注底层的复杂性。 CloudRail Java桌面应用程序的主要特点和优势包括:...
打开 build.gradle.kts 并应用 Java 插件:我们的应用程序需要两个 JxBrowser依赖项。 一个包含带有 ...
这次发布修复了LauncherConf类会报错的问题,在类初始化的时候万一启动程序在用户目录下的jar文件被删除时。 MDIFramework提供了一个马上可以使用的基础架构来简化开发MDI风格的Java桌面应用程。它兼顾了整体架构应用程序的主窗口,一个标签式的架构,包含可打印的HTML消息,等等。它提供了一个通用的API来管理冗长的Actioin...
在Java技术应用的各个领域中,PC桌面应用开发可能是最不引人注目的了,在这块它被QT和微软系列的WPF/WinForms压得死死的,几无翻身的机会,现在似乎就连Electron的名气都比它大。 其实,Java的GUI框架——JavaFX在技术上并不比对手差多少,各种工具也基本上都齐备—— ...
一、Swing框架简介 Swing是AWT(Abstract Window Toolkit)的一个扩展,完全用Java编写,支持自定义组件和复杂的用户界面。 二、环境搭建 Swing作为Java的标准部分,无需额外安装。只需确保使用的是Java 1.2或更高版本。 三、创建基本窗口 使用JFrame类创建一个基本的窗口,并设置标题、大小和关闭操作。